It's so awful it happened. I worked at a vid store back in the day & remember loving Clownhouse when it first came out. He got money from Francis Ford Coppola to make it, $250,000, got to use Coppola's home to film it & filmed it on George Lucas' cameras he filmed American Graffiti on. It was *genuinely* a good movie but now it's the movie where he raped a kid. >In 1988, director [Victor Salva](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Victor_Salva) was convicted of the sexual abuse of Nathan Forrest Winters, the 12-year-old lead actor who played Casey, during production, including videotaping one of the encounters. Commercial videotapes and magazines containing child pornography were also found at his home. After serving 15 months of a three-year prison term, Salva was released on parole. >Winters came forward again in 1995, when Salva's film [*Powder*](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Powder_(1995_film)) was released. Winters picketed a screening in Westwood. That said, back when Powder came out not many people were talking about this & they definitely weren't talking about it when Clownhouse came out, Winters, the kid who was molested, seems to have tried talking about it. I hope Winters is doing well & has gotten the right kind of help.
